MIDDLE COLLEGE AT GTCC-GREENSBORO
Middle College at GTCC-Greensboro is a public high school that is part of the Guilford County Schools school district, located in Greensboro, NC with about 131 students offering grade levels from 9th Grade to 13th Grade. With about 7 teachers, Middle College at GTCC-Greensboro has a student/teacher ratio of about 18:1. The national average for public schools is about 15:1. A lower student/teacher ratio is a key factor that determines how much a teacher can devote his/her time to each individual student thus improving, or reducing (in the event of a higher student/teacher ratio) the attention each student is given for their educational needs.
Middle College at GTCC-Greensboro is a specialized, innovative public high school located on the campus of Guilford Technical Community College (GTCC) in Greensboro, North Carolina. Operating as a partnership between Guilford County Schools and the community college, the school is designed for students who are looking for a unique, non-traditional learning environment. It serves as an early college program where students can bridge the gap between their secondary education and post-secondary goals, often completing high school credits alongside college-level coursework.
The academic experience at Middle College at GTCC-Greensboro is characterized by a smaller, supportive community that emphasizes maturity, self-motivation, and academic rigor. By placing students on a college campus, the school provides them with early exposure to higher education, allowing them to earn college credits toward a degree or certificate while still working toward their high school diploma. This environment is particularly well-suited for students who thrive in a collegiate setting, wish to get a head start on their professional or academic future, and prefer a more personalized, focused approach to their high school experience.
